Have I got news for you!

So April 15, 2014, is the big Charter channel shuffle. I was not very pleased at what I saw when I turned on my TV this morning. I always watch KFVS news when I am getting ready for work and usually have my TV set to the HD CBS on Charter Channel 707. I flipped on the TV with the channel set at 707 and what do I see? Porn! Channel 707 had the Showtime logo displayed on screen (but was still listed as KFVS in the guide) and was playing a movie with very graphic nudity. This is not what I wanted to see at 5 in the morning. Totally unacceptable. What would have happened if my child would have turned on the TV instead of me? I double-checked the new channel lineup that Charter provided and it listed 707 as CBS HD. That tells me the station wasn't going to change. When I got home this evening, I checked again and 707 was back to CBS HD. I plan to let Charter know how unacceptable this is. This entire channel shuffle is very unnecessary in my opinion and very costly to the customers. Every few years we end up having to memorize new channel numbers. Remember the days when TV used to be free? Now we have hundreds of stations and have to pay dearly for the few that we watch. A big change like the one Charter is doing is going to better the customer? Yeah, but it comes with a huge price tag. Our bills are going to increase to pay for this change, maybe not today but very soon. But their service won't get any better.
